About Bakhra Village

Bakhra is a large village in Ratua I tehsil, in the district of Maldah, West Bengal.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 3,491, made up of 1,765 males and 1,726 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 978 females per 1000 males. The village covers 137.1 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 732205,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Bakhra

The census records public bus service for Bakhra as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
